Corporate inaction on climate change
Literature in the field of corporate sustainability and climate change emphasizes company strategies on climate action and the specific measures firms take to act upon climate change issues. Despite corporate action on climate change, the majority of companies fail to reduce their greenhouse gas emissions effectively as they do not implement far-reaching mitigation measures. In the literature, reasons for corporate inaction on climate change have scarcely been examined. Inaction can be observed at the individual, organizational and institutional levels. The study intends to shed light on the complexity of reasons for corporate inaction on climate change and gives an outlook for possible future research.
